I have the following questtion regarding the replacement of disks and not updated information in the vDev:
First of all some infos about my setup:
- Supermicro X10SLM+-F
- Intel Xeon E3-1271v3
- 32 GB ECC RAM
- LSI SAS 9300-4i HBA
- 3x 3 TB WD Red
- N4F 11.1.0.4 - Atomics (revision 5019)
I replaced my disks to increase the size of my NAS as following:
- connect new HDD (8 TB WD Red) to (free) Port 4 of LSI HBA
- Disks > ZFS > Pools > Tools > Replace
-- Choose old disk on Port 3 and new disk on Port 4
- Resilvering
- detach old disk from Port 3
---
- attach new disk on Port 3
- Disks > ZFS > Pools > Tools > Replace
-- Choose old disk on Port 2 and new disk on Port 3
- Resilvering
If I now look into "Disks > ZFS > Pools > Virtual Device" I only see the two old disks. Why is the vDev not updated?
Anyone an idea? Thank you!!
